Focused Investment in 15 Projects Across 6 Sectors
Hampyeong-gun, Jeollanam-do announced on the 5th that County Governor Lee Sang-ik, together with Kim Young-rok, Governor of Jeollanam-do, unveiled the ‘Hampyeong Future Regional Development Vision’ at the Jeollanam-do Provincial Office to overcome the local reality facing a crisis due to continuous population decline and to bring about new changes and leaps forward.
This announcement is the result of Hampyeong-gun, which is experiencing a crisis of its population falling below 30,000 due to rapid population decline, consistently proposing regional development projects to Jeollanam-do and closely cooperating to achieve this outcome.
The six vision areas announced that day are ▲ AI advanced livestock industry convergence valley, ▲ Hampyeong Bay marine tourism hub development, ▲ global data center cluster, ▲ future convergence advanced new town, and ▲ SOC expansion and accessibility improvement.
The 15 detailed projects include ▲ establishment of an AI advanced livestock industry full-cycle industrialization base complex, ▲ development of a marine leisure complex, ▲ attraction of AI-linked data centers, ▲ expansion of metropolitan roads, National Road No. 23, and Local Road No. 838, ▲ establishment of rental smart farms, and ▲ creation of a comprehensive leisure and sports town, totaling approximately 1.71 trillion KRW.
Hampyeong-gun plans to realize this vision by fostering future industries such as AI advanced livestock industry, marine tourism, and data centers, constructing an advanced new town with self-sufficient functions, and expanding SOC and improving accessibility to lay the foundation for regional development.
Governor Lee Sang-ik stated, “The announcement of the Hampyeong future development vision marks a meaningful starting point for new changes and leaps forward in Hampyeong,” and added, “We will strive to ensure that the projects announced today do not remain mere declarations but are implemented one by one, ultimately leading to tangible regional development achievements.”
